ORDER
The petitioners are the accused in Crime No.379 of 2021 of Sreekrishnapuram Police Station, which is now pending before the Judicial First Class Magistrate Court, Ottappalam as C.C. No.83/2022. The offence alleged against the petitioners is under Section 498A of IPC. The 2 nd respondent is the defacto complainant who is the wife of the 1st petitioner. The petitioners 2 and 3 are the parents of the 1st petitioner and the 4th petitioner is the sister of the 1st petitioner. This Crl.M.C. is filed to quash Annexure A1 FIR and Annexure A3 final report submitted in the aforesaid case.
2. Heard Sri.Mini Gangadharan, the learned counsel appearing for the petitioners, Smt.Maya Antharjanam appearing for the State and Sri.V.A.Hakeem learned counsel for the 2 nd respondent.
3. The prayer to quash the proceedings is sought by the
petitioners on the ground that the matter has been settled between the parties. Today when the matter came up for consideration, the defacto complainant was physically present along with her counsel. The learned counsel for the defacto complainant as well as the defacto complainant confirmed that the matter is settled. They have also stated that, the affidavit filed along with this Crl.M.C. substantiating the settlement between the parties is executed by her. The learned Public Prosecutor also interacted with the defacto complainant and before the the learned Public Prosecutor also the defacto complainant confirmed the settlement of the dispute.
4. On going through the records it is evident that, the
dispute which is the subject matter of the crime is private in nature a and no public interest is involved. In such circumstances, I am of the view that, the powers of this Court under Section 482 of Cr.P.C. can be invoked for the purpose of terminating the proceedings prematurely taking note of the settlement arrived between the parties. In the result, this Crl.M.C. is allowed. Annexure A3 final report submitted in Crime No.379/2021 of Sreekrishnapuram Police Station which is now pending before the Judicial First Class Magistrate Court, Ottappalam as C.C. No.83/2022 is hereby quashed. Sd/- ZIYAD RAHMAN A.A.
